Job details
The Field Sales Engineer (FSE) is a field-based, technical sales role that is responsible for an assigned sales territory. The FSE is a vital member and leader within the Account Management Team (AMT) and is responsible for meeting and exceeding the AMT annual bookings quota. The primary role of the FSE is to lead all aspects of the technical sales process by collaborating with other members of the AMT and Field Service. For some larger volume territories, the FSE may support and be locally supervised by the District Sales Manager (DSM) for the territory. Requirements: Candidates must be fluent in verbal and written French and English. 3+ years of capital equipment business-to-business sales experience. Outside sales preferred. A technical bachelor's degree in engineering, materials science, or physics. A curious attitude that prioritizes the understanding of customer needs. Drive, focus, and self-motivation to meet annual sales goals. The ability to work independently and collaboratively with the eastern Canadian account management team. Responsibilities: Collaborate with the Eastern Canadian sales and service team to achieve or exceed quarterly and annual bookings targets from Saskatchewan to Newfoundland. Conduct compelling product demonstrations and technical presentations to customers showcasing the benefits and value of Instron’s highly differentiated products. Develop and implement a proactive territory management plan that ensures bookings plans and sales objectives are met or exceeded, including a strategy to proactively increase market share within target industries and applications. Form trusted partnerships with Instron’s customers by providing exceptional support and promptly addressing inquiries or concerns. Stay up to date with industry trends, market developments, and competitor activities to collaborate with business units at corporate headquarters and identify sales opportunities. Additional information: Company vehicle, paid training, cell phone allowance, laptop Medical, vision and dental insurance Career growth opportunities through training, and continuous learning Registered Retired Savings Plan retirement savings with a company match
